Output 508503fcccb4ae670fea5b1768ea803ea644546932081f75be637ec86f84c181:0

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c63b867e47ba9df8cef736e32e0a134b8a6874 OP_EQUAL
address
383x2DYVFoHvNAKerzQJSJdp8KCJqPtFKQ
transaction
508503fcccb4ae670fea5b1768ea803ea644546932081f75be637ec86f84c181
spent
true